New Inter Faith Week catches imagination

by Pat Ashworth

THE Communities Secretary, John Denham, launched the first national Inter Faith Week yesterday. The week runs from 15 to 21 Nov­em­ber, and aims to strengthen good relations at all levels.

The Jubilee Debt Campaign has chosen the occasion to launch new action on global poverty, with a par­ticular focus on poor-country debt. The steering group has represent­atives from the Buddhist, Christian, Hindu, Jewish, Muslim and Sikh communities.

The Bishop of Guildford’s Christian-Muslim Leaders’ Forum drew attention in a statement on Wednesday to the Common Word document, sent by Islamic scholars to the leaders of Christian Churches in 2007. “Muslims and Christians to­gether make up well over half of the world’s population. Without peace and justice between these two com­munities, there can be no meaningful peace in the world,” the forum says.

The Sikh broadcaster and journa­list Dr Indarjit Singh will deliver the St Wilfrid Lecture at Ripon Cathedral next Thursday, the first person from another faith to do so.

The Cambridge Union is hosting a debate on Wednesday between six speakers, which include Vivian Wine­man, president of the Board of Deputies of British Jews, and Dr Peter Cave, who chairs the Human Philo­sophers Group. The event is one of 30 organised by the East of England Faiths Council.

Many C of E schools will be closely involved with schools of other faiths in the week’s events. The Archbishop of Canterbury will visit the London Inter Faith Centre on Tuesday to meet students from 12 independent sec­ond­ary schools, representing differ­ent traditions within the great faiths.
